Event Description

LATEST WEATHER FORECAST HERE

MEET AT VICTORIA SQUARE AT 7:30 am for 7:45 am departure.

Accommodation available at the salubrious Clare Hotel http://www.clarehotel.com.au/ but you are free to bunk up wherever you wish.

Attendees are asked when RSVP'ing to this event to nominate the group they will be riding in the leg to Clare.
 
Faster group:
29-32 km/h avg speed
Riders: A.V.O., Dr.Cadence, A-Man, Peter, Michael

Moderate group: 25-28 km/h avg speed
Riders: SmilingAssassin, Scott, DarkHorse, DetourMan

Course: Victoria Square - King William Rd, O'Connell St, Prospect Rd, Port Wakefield Highway, SOB, through Gawler and then Main Highway to Clare

Distance: 142km each way


Last year it was held on May 21/22
It was a unseasonal windy weekend with strong northerly winds 30-35km/h. The minimum temperature in Clare on the Saturday night was approx. 8 degrees

Day 1 last year - http://app.strava.com/activities/1086769
Average speed: 24.6 km/h.
Elapsed time: 7 hrs 51 mins

Day 2 last year - http://app.strava.com/activities/1086771
Average speed: 38.1 km/h.
Elapsed time: 4 hrs 57 mins
